  1. Have a spa evening (at home) 

Who doesn’t love some pampering? 

The two of you should stock up on body butters, face masks, hair masks and eye creams for a spa evening. You’ll be able to put your feet up while on the couch, sit back, stick a movie on, and relax with your different grooming products applied. Remember, though, don’t fall asleep on the couch if you’re wearing a face or hair mask – it could stain the material if it rubs off! 

  1. Go for a walk 

Because COVID-19 has caused so many problems, it’s not possible to visit as many places for dates as before. However, you can’t beat the classic ‘go for a nice walk’ date – it’s simple, easy, and gets you out of the house. Look on Google Maps to see if there are any walkable destinations near your home – if not, you can always drive or get an Uber somewhere for a country walk.

  1. Draw each other 

It’s time to get the paper and drawing pencils out! 

Drawing each other is a great way to have some fun and laughs on a date. You don’t need to be professional artists to do this, either – but there’s nothing wrong with some friendly competition to see who can draw the best. 

When you’re finished, you could even frame the drawings. In fact, you might be so good that it inspires you to paint each other next time, instead.
